28. Rail
Project “Pendolino” Finland 2009
Shipment of 16 complete trains (6 cars each train), from Savigliano (Italy) to Turku (Finland).
Car dimensions : L (max) 27,2 m x W 3,2 m x H 4,1 m /Unit Weight 55 000 Kg

30. Oil & Gas Onshore
In 2003 GEODIS finalized a long term partnership with the company EXXON in AFRICA (up to Dec 2010).
Organization of door to door logistics services from various locations worldwide to final destination Cameroon & Chad –
including Inbound logistics Supply Management /Warehousing and Hub Cross-docking./PO Management /Quantity control
/ Outbond Logistics Flow/Supply packing/Freight Forwarding /International Transport to the production sites/ Incountry
Contract services (Import and Transit, Trucking/rail transport Douala / Kome)

31. Petrochemical
• Geodis Wilson Project Singapore 2009
• Shipment of an air receiver column from Singapore to Jurong Island (Singapore).
• Dimensions : L 89,00 m / Weight 400 000 kg
• Load out applied engineering
